引言
隔空控物,这一听起来仿佛来自科幻世界的概念,正逐渐成为现实。随着科技的发展,人们对于非接触式交互的需求日益增长。本文将深入探讨隔空控物技术的原理,并提供详细的材料准备全攻略,帮助读者轻松掌握这一未来科技的奥秘。
隔空控物技术原理
隔空控物技术,又称非接触式交互技术,主要通过电磁场、声波、红外线等手段实现。以下是一些常见的隔空控物技术原理:
电磁场原理
电磁场原理是通过发射和接收电磁波来实现物体控制。例如,无线充电技术就是利用电磁场原理,将能量从发射端传输到接收端。
声波原理
声波原理是利用声波发射和接收器之间的相互作用来实现物体控制。例如,超声波传感器可以通过检测声波的反射来测量距离。
红外线原理
红外线原理是通过发射和接收红外线来实现物体控制。例如,遥控器就是利用红外线原理来控制电视等家电。
材料准备全攻略
电磁场原理材料
- 发射器:电磁波发射模块,如无线充电模块。
- 接收器:电磁波接收模块,如无线充电接收器。
- 天线:用于发射和接收电磁波的设备。
- 电路板:用于连接和驱动各个部件的电路板。
声波原理材料
- 发射器:超声波发生器。
- 接收器:超声波传感器。
- 放大器:用于放大超声波信号的设备。
- 电路板:用于连接和驱动各个部件的电路板。
红外线原理材料
- 发射器:红外线发射管。
- 接收器:红外线接收管。
- 解码器:用于解码红外信号的控制模块。
- 电路板:用于连接和驱动各个部件的电路板。
实践案例
以下是一个简单的隔空控物实践案例,使用电磁场原理实现无线充电:
# 电磁场原理无线充电示例代码
# 发射器代码
class Transmitter:
def __init__(self, power):
self.power = power
def send_power(self):
print(f"Sending {self.power} watts of power...")
# 接收器代码
class Receiver:
def __init__(self):
self.charge_level = 0
def receive_power(self, power):
self.charge_level += power
print(f"Received {power} watts, current charge level: {self.charge_level}%")
# 实例化发射器和接收器
transmitter = Transmitter(power=10)
receiver = Receiver()
# 发送能量
transmitter.send_power()
receiver.receive_power(power=10)
总结
隔空控物技术作为未来科技的重要方向,其应用前景广阔。通过本文的详细介绍,相信读者已经对隔空控物技术的原理和材料准备有了清晰的认识。希望这篇文章能够帮助读者轻松掌握这一未来科技的奥秘。
